How do I forward my mail when I move away from Bradley, Maine?

To forward your mail when moving, visit the Bradley Post Office and fill out a change of address form. This will ensure that your mail is redirected to your new address. You can also submit a change of address request online through the USPS website.

Can I put my mail on hold while I am traveling, and how do I do it at the Bradley Post Office?

Yes, you can put your mail on hold while traveling by visiting the Bradley Post Office and filling out a hold mail request form. This will ensure that your mail is held at the office until you return, and you can pick it up at your convenience. You can also submit a hold mail request online through the USPS website.

How do I send certified mail with return receipt from the Bradley Post Office?

To send certified mail with return receipt from the Bradley Post Office, you will need to fill out a certified mail form and attach it to your mailpiece. The staff at the office can assist you in completing the form and ensuring that your mail is properly prepared for certified mail service.
